B. About Your Role

We are looking for a Senior Product Owner to join our Product Development Team. In this role, you will be responsible for operationalizing leadership's high-level vision into structured, executable deliverables for the Development, BA, and QA teams.

You will drive Agile process implementation, maintain the product backlog and roadmap, structure requirement gathering and documentation standards, and ensure disciplined delivery execution.

This role is execution-focused, not strategy-driven — ideal for someone who is organized, process-oriented, and passionate about scaling high-quality product development operations. If you are an expert in Agile product management, thrive in process-driven environments, and are excited about establishing product excellence internally, we would love to hear from you.


C. Key Responsibilities

  • Manage the end-to-end product backlog, including epics, user stories, features, and releases.
  • Create and maintain product documentation standards (BRDs, PRDs, FRDs, user journey maps, stakeholder approval formats).
  • Break down leadership’s high-level vision into actionable roadmaps and quarterly deliverables.
  • Implement and enforce Agile practices (sprint planning, standups, retrospectives, backlog grooming) across Development, BA, and QA teams.
  • Work closely with BAs, Devs, and QA to ensure requirements are clearly defined, signed-off, and executed.
  • Standardize formats for requirement gathering, stakeholder sign-offs, user mapping, and sprint goal setting.
  • Present product development progress to leadership, summarizing accomplishments, risks, and milestones.
  • Champion cross-team collaboration and continuously raise the Agile maturity of the organization.
  • Facilitate seamless communication and expectation management between execution teams and leadership.

Success Metrics

  • Agile Process Adherence:

    100% of teams following agreed Agile ceremonies and practices.
  • Backlog Readiness:

    90%+ of sprint backlog stories are ready (properly defined, estimated, and approved) before sprint start.
  • Roadmap Alignment:

    Roadmaps delivered quarterly, with clear linkage to leadership’s vision and business priorities.
  • Delivery Predictability:

    85%+ of committed sprint goals achieved consistently.
  • Documentation Quality:

    100% of epics, features, and major changes documented as per the defined format and accessible to all teams.
